Upgrade request Problem - insufficient Points
 
I have a return business flight with 1 other pax to China on Qf codes and metal booked in I. The BNE-ADL leg is in Y due to lack of inventory of I.
I was told could not wait list with an I ticket. So applied for upgrade using points.
Had a text message - "Declined due to insufficient points"
Contact QFF who said that one seat was available but because upgrade was for 2 people on the ticket that it rejected it this way. She seamed a bit confused by why it should have happened and replaced the request.
Just got the same message again about 12 hours later.
There is way plenty of points and she checked it was not trying to get the points from the other passengers account.

Any one had any experience with this - having to use points to try an upgrade an already business class ticket is rude (if not strictly wrong) but it seems system a little broken here.

Avail is showing J9 C5 D3 I0 U1

It sounds like a bug that is causing the message "Declined due to insufficient points" although the reason is lack of availability of 2 seats (although there is 1 available). In other words, rejection may be correct, but the message is wrong. That's my guess anyway.

You may be able to ODU, but it sounds a bit galling that you're having to use points to upgrade due to lack of domestic I class availability (unless of course you were given a discount for your through-ticket due to that).

Contact QF (or the authority that issued your tickets) ask them to separate the bookings. They'll create a PNR for the other passenger and you should be able to upgrade whichever separately.
